国产探花免费观看_亚洲丰满少妇自慰呻吟_97日韩有码在线_资源在线日韩欧美_一区二区精品毛片,辰东完美世界有声小说,欢乐颂第一季,yy玄幻小说排行榜完本

首頁(yè) > 編程 > Python > 正文

Python使用requests提交HTTP表單的方法

2020-02-16 00:20:35
字體:
來(lái)源:轉(zhuǎn)載
供稿:網(wǎng)友

Python的requests庫(kù), 其口號(hào)是HTTP for humans,堪稱(chēng)最好用的HTTP庫(kù)。

使用requests庫(kù),可以使用數(shù)行代碼實(shí)現(xiàn)自動(dòng)化的http操作。以http post,即瀏覽器提交一個(gè)表格數(shù)據(jù)到web服務(wù)器,為例,來(lái)說(shuō)明requests的使用。

無(wú)cookie

import requestsurl = 'www.test.org'data = {'username': 'user', 'password': '123456'}response = requests.post(url, data)

有cookie——顯示添加cookie

import requestsurl = 'www.test.org'data = {'username': 'user', 'password': '123456'}headers = {'Cookie': 'SshCAcaoCookie-6-2=qQOGw0eWu7vZiumIAezdJJEUL3w-'}response = requests.post(url, data, headers=headers)

有cookie——隱式添加cookie

import requestsurl = 'www.test.org'data = {'username': 'user', 'password': '123456'}session = requests.Session()session.get(url)response = session.post(url, data,)

在調(diào)試以上腳本時(shí),可以通過(guò)對(duì)比使用瀏覽器和使用Python腳本時(shí)的tcpdump文件,來(lái)定位問(wèn)題。使用tcpdump抓包時(shí),建議指定網(wǎng)卡和端口號(hào)抓包:

tcpdump -i network_interface_name port port_num -s 0 -w ./1.pcap

以上這篇Python使用requests提交HTTP表單的方法就是小編分享給大家的全部?jī)?nèi)容了,希望能給大家一個(gè)參考,也希望大家多多支持武林站長(zhǎng)站。

發(fā)表評(píng)論 共有條評(píng)論
用戶(hù)名: 密碼:
驗(yàn)證碼: 匿名發(fā)表
主站蜘蛛池模板: 高邮市| 石棉县| 慈溪市| 陇南市| 定安县| 广德县| 句容市| 庄浪县| 湟中县| 通渭县| 辽阳市| 唐河县| 邵武市| 西昌市| 怀来县| 女性| 独山县| 双桥区| 山东省| 长汀县| 雅安市| 铜陵市| 会宁县| 靖州| 南阳市| 道孚县| 子洲县| 靖西县| 萨嘎县| 乐亭县| 新巴尔虎右旗| 江陵县| 鹤庆县| 龙里县| 南木林县| 偃师市| 法库县| 闽侯县| 淮滨县| 柯坪县| 白玉县|